3. The v£ Reward System
3.1 What Are v£ Rewards?
v£ (pronounced “v-pounds”) are digital reward credits issued on the vBuy platform. They function as vouchers — not as currency, cryptocurrency, or legal tender. v£ have no cash value outside the Platform.
3.2 Earning v£
- You earn v£ rewards automatically on every eligible purchase.
- The reward percentage is set by the individual Seller for each product (minimum 8%).
- v£ rewards are calculated on the GBP-paid portion of your order only. If you use v£ to partially pay for an order, rewards are earned only on the remaining GBP amount.
- Rewards are earned on both product prices and shipping costs.
3.3 Using v£ at Checkout
- At checkout, v£1 = £1. This exchange rate is fixed and will not change.
- You may apply any amount of your available v£ balance to reduce the GBP total of your order.
- v£ discounts are applied proportionally across all items and Sellers in your cart.
3.4 The 30-Day Pending Period
- All v£ earned from a purchase are subject to a mandatory 30-day pending period before they become available to spend.
- This period is required by applicable consumer protection regulations and cannot be overridden.
- During the pending period, v£ are visible in your wallet but cannot be used.
- If an order is refunded during the pending period, the associated v£ rewards are automatically reversed.
3.5 Restrictions
- v£ cannot be withdrawn as cash, transferred to another user, or exchanged outside the Platform.
- v£ can only be spent on future purchases on vBuy at the fixed rate of v£1 = £1.
- v£ balances are non-transferable and have no expiry date, unless your account is terminated for breach of these Terms.
- vBuy reserves the right to adjust v£ balances to correct errors or reverse fraudulent transactions.
3.6 Purchasing v£
You may purchase additional v£ at a rate of £1 = v£1 through approved channels (such as Vowchers voucher codes or directly at checkout). Purchased v£ are subject to the same usage rules as earned v£.
